Decimals are read to the right of the decimal point. .63 is read as “sixty-three hundredths.” .136 is read as “one hundred thirty-six thousandths.” .5625 is read as “five thousand six hundred twenty-five ten-thousandths.” 3.5 is read “three and five tenths.” Whole numbers and decimals are abbreviated. 6.625 is spoken as “six, point six two five.” One place .0 tenths Two places .00 hundredths Three places .000 thousandths Four places ten-thousandths Five places hundred-thousandths

7 5. Multiplication of Decimals
Rules For Multiplying Decimals Multiply the same as whole numbers. Count the number of decimal places to the right of the decimal point in both numbers. Position the decimal point in the answer by starting at the extreme right digit and counting as many places to the left as there are in the total number of decimal places found in both numbers. 8 6. Division of Decimals Rules For Dividing Decimals
Place number to be divided (dividend) inside the division box. Place divisor outside. Move decimal point in divisor to extreme right. (Becomes whole number) Move decimal point same number of places in dividend. (NOTE: zeros are added in dividend if it has fewer digits than divisor). Mark position of decimal point in answer (quotient) directly above decimal point in dividend. Divide as whole numbers - place each figure in quotient directly above digit involved in dividend. Add zeros after the decimal point in the dividend if it cannot be divided evenly by the divisor. Continue division until quotient has as many places as required for the answer. Solve:
